Let's be blunt. The last four years have been the worst freight market this industry can remember. Rates in the gutter, costs through the roof, capacity swinging hard. Carriers parked trucks. Brokers watched margins disappear. Shippers, traders, and merchandisers fought to keep freight moving and budgets intact.

If you're still standing, you didn't get lucky. You got lean, you got smarter, and you built the relationships that carried you through.

Now it's breaking. Capacity has left the market and rates are firming. Every credible forecast points the same way: the rebound builds into 2027. And the upswing won't be handed out evenly. It goes to the carriers, brokers, shippers, and traders with the relationships, the rate intel, and the playbook to grab it first.
